About Francesco Logoluso

Francesco Logoluso is a scholar working on Nephrology,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ism and Genetics, having authored 14 papers that have together received 336 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Growth Hormone and Insulin-like Growth Factors (4 papers), Thyroid and Parathyroid Surgery (4 papers) and Pituitary Gland Disorders and Treatments (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Nephrology (75 citations), Hematology (82 citations) and Transplantation (16 citations). Francesco Logoluso has collaborated with scholars based in Italy, France and United States. Frequent co-authors include Mario Testini, Francesco Giorgino, Angela Gurrado, Luigi Morrone, Francesca Schena, Antonio Schena, Giovanni Stallone, Salvatore Di Paolo, Giuseppe Piccinni and Germana Lissidini. Their work appears in journals such as Diabetes, Transplantation and The Oncologist.
